WebFrom around 6 months. To start with, your baby only needs a small amount of solid food, once a day, at a time that suits you both. You can start weaning with single vegetables and fruits – try blended, mashed, or soft cooked sticks of parsnip, broccoli, potato, yam, sweet potato, carrot, apple or pear. Their skins tend to be scaly, pink and thicker than the skins on sweet potatoes. But the easiest way to tell … cuny english phd applicationWebAug 6, 2024 · When can babies eat yams? Yams, when soft and fully cooked, may be introduced as soon as baby is ready for solids, which is usually around 6 months of age.
